Java导出Excel图表是一个常见的需求,可以通过一些开源库来实现。本文将介绍如何使用Apache POI库来实现Java导出Excel图表的功能。 ## 1. 准备工作 首先,你需要在项目中引入Apache POI库的依赖。在Maven项目中,可以在`pom.xml`文件中添加以下依赖: ```xml org.apache.poi po
原创 2023-12-14 11:22:08
271阅读
python导出Excel图表类前期准备就绪,网上已有类似的导出Excel图表类,但是在后面的使用中发现问题,即关键函数已在下面代码中标红:调用代码:执行成功,接下来到上面设置的导出路径查看导出的图片:从文件查看中看到,图表文件已经成功导出图表导出的问题但是,图表导出并未能完全成功,从以上文件信息中看到导出的图片存在0字节的文件;点击查看图片可发现提示为空文件具体原因分析:经过本人多次的测试和
# Java Excel导出图表 在日常工作中,我们经常需要将数据导出Excel表格中,并且可能需要生成各种图表来展示数据的趋势和分析结果。Java作为一种常用的编程语言,也提供了一些库来帮助我们实现这一目的。在本文中,我们将介绍如何使用Java导出Excel表格并生成图表。 ## 导出Excel表格 首先,我们需要使用Java库来操作Excel。Apache POI是一个流行的Java
原创 2024-02-21 05:29:27
372阅读
目录背景POI版本自定义注解逻辑代码实现测试背景最近项目需要导出数据到Excel 表格中,在包装好获取表格方法之后,剩下的就是往单元格中添加数据和添加标题。写了一两个地方之后发现设置数据这块东西基本都是类似的重复代码,无非就是设置的数据不一样而已,看到这样的代码就很烦,想把它们封装起来,首先想到的就是通过自定义注解的方式来实现。POI版本我用的是POI导出Excel,版本如下:<!-- ht
转载 2023-05-27 14:50:38
561阅读
当前导出PDF工具java后端如何导出像前端用echarts那么漂亮而且还有带有图表的PDF呢,或者图片。目前后端导出word或者excel都是有县城的jar,导出简单的图表也有的简单的jfreechart总结一下用java生成PDF的方法: A、itext-PdfStamper pdfStamper(俗称抠模板):代码简单 模板要先提供,且字段长度固定、不灵活 B、itext-Document
# 实现java导出excel包含图表的步骤 ## 整体流程 首先,让我们来看一下整个实现过程的步骤: ```mermaid erDiagram 理解需求 --> 寻找合适的库 --> 导入库 --> 创建excel文件 --> 创建sheet --> 插入数据 --> 添加图表 --> 导出excel文件 ``` ## 详细步骤及代码 ### 1. 理解需求 在开始实现之前,
原创 2024-05-29 06:40:26
147阅读
(说明,原文转载链接出自:)实现思路:1.由于前端通过echarts生成图形报表,所以后台没必要通过再弄一个插件生成一次图表;2.将echarts生成的图片获取base64编码,将编码内容post参数传入后台;3.后台接收到图片参数进行解码,生成本地图片;4.利用poi创建的HSSFPatriarch对象.createPicture()方法将图片写入excel单元格中。导出方法代码:/**
转载 2024-02-02 11:19:50
244阅读
一、导出报表概述导出报表是实际开发过程中经常用到的操作,没学过的觉得非常神奇,学过的其实也就那么回事。但是很多程序员其实都是拿来就用,并没有好好思考其中的原理,俗称“CV工程”。个人觉得技术这回事,你自己看懂别人的代码叫了解,能跟着敲出来才算入门。第一步、创建工具类 首先,我们可以定义一个工具类并定义好静态方法,向方法中传入sheet名称,表头,内容等参数,然后传回HSSFWorkbook对象(E
引言java后台导出表格一般分两种:注解配置(@Excel)导出和自定义导出注解配置(@Excel导出添加poi依赖<dependency> <groupId>cn.afterturn</groupId> <artifactId>easypoi-base</artifactId> <version>${easypoi.
转载 2023-06-15 09:35:00
261阅读
开发过程中经常需要用到数据的导入导出功能,之前用的是POI,这次使用JXL,JXL相对于POI来说要轻量简洁许多,在数据量不大的情况下还是非常实用的。这里做一下使用JXL的学习记录。首先需要导入相应的jar包,pom.xml中添加如下内容即可 <dependency> <groupId>net.sourceforge.jexcelap
转载 2023-09-29 10:19:27
57阅读
最近接触过许多报表导出功能,也用过多种工具进行导出功能的实现,但对于图表导出一直没有仔细的去展开研究和探讨,直到最近略微整理了下这方面的需求和技术攻克。 首先导出excel功能的实现主要有JXL、JXCELL、POI等工具。目前只实现了JXL和JXCELL。JXL:  先介绍下JXL:  jxl是一个韩国人写的java操作excel的工具, 在开源世界中,有两套比较有影响的A
转载 2023-08-30 09:26:20
83阅读
通过java操作excel表格的工具类库支持Excel 95-2000的所有版本生成Excel 2000标准格式支持字体、数字、日期操作能够修饰单元格属性支持图像和图表应该说以上功能已经能够大致满足我们的需要。最关键的是这套API是纯Java的,并不依赖Windows系统,即使运行在Linux下,它同样能够正确的处理Excel文件。另外需要说明的是,这套API对图形和图表的支持很有限,而且仅仅识别
转载 2023-07-02 11:06:45
56阅读
由于项目使用的是easyui,现在需要做一个导出Excel功能,Excel内包含表格内容和图片信息。查看easyui的官网发现有扩展datagrid-export.js可以在前端导出excel,于是拿来使用,发现无法导出多级表头,改写源码后可以导出多级表头的excel,但是没法在前端导出echarts的base64编码的图片。因此使用Java后台采用poi来导出excel。考虑到前面已经在前端由t
转载 2023-09-01 12:20:12
127阅读
java基于jxl 导出excel例子
转载 2023-06-02 11:14:44
146阅读
1、创建XSSFWorkbook对象(也就是excel文档对象)2、通过XSSFWorkbook对象创建sheet对象(也就是excel中的sheet)3、通过sheet对象创建XSSFRow对象(row行对象)4、通过XSSFRow对象创建列cell并set值(列名)5、处理数据循环表头(业务需要)service impl层  @Override public Statisti
转载 2023-07-11 13:51:43
0阅读
java中后台导出excel的话,有两种方案,一是使用poi(不过由于是windows版本的,存在不兼容,但功能更多,更强大),而是使用jxl(纯java编写,不过兼容,简单一些),可以设置输出的excel横向还是竖向、A4纸还是A3纸的尺寸大小。由于只需要简单的导出excel,所以选择jxl工具,只需要下载一个jar就可以了jxl.jar.       以下是我的
转载 2016-11-24 20:25:44
97阅读
一、SpreadJS 简介SpreadJS 是一款基于 HTML5 的纯 JavaScript 电子表格和网格功能控件,以“高速低耗、纯前端、零依赖”为产品特色,可嵌入任何操作系统,同时满足 .NET、Java、响应式 Web 应用及移动跨平台的表格数据处理和类 Excel 的表格应用开发,为终端用户带来亲切的 Excel 体验。本文将以 xlsx 文件格式为例,展示如何使用 SpreadJS 实
java - - 导入、导出表格到 Excel文档????????????????????????1、poi导出 – 较复杂表格1、??先导入依赖<!-- 导入导出依赖 --> <dependency> <groupId>org.apache.poi</groupId> <artifactI
转载 2024-06-21 12:52:18
143阅读
      最近做项目的过程中需要实现导出excel,他们有已经写好的实现,但是只是针对他们业务逻辑的,所以我就想能不能封装一个通用的方法,于是找出之前用过的导出方法,然后照着封装了一个,还可以。但是两个方法也有不同,一个用的是WritableWorkbook(JXL),另一个用的是HSSFWorkbook(POI)。我们先来看看两者有什
转载 2023-09-22 19:11:32
46阅读
项目中的需求是需要将前端页面展示的echarts图片生成,并将图片导出excel中,实现图片随excel下载,在这先展示如何将echarts的图片导出excel中,后续再补上如何导出到word模板中,使用的技术是POI 先上最终效果图 前端展示效果: 导出后到excel的效果1、前端代码:<div class="block-title"> <h3>标题1</h3
转载 2023-07-16 18:49:00
204阅读
  • 1
  • 2
  • 3
  • 4
  • 5